| Metric | Latest Estimate | Source / Period |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Approximate Market Capitalization | $1.8 to $2.0 Trillion | Major Exchanges, 2024 | Share price multiplied by outstanding shares, intraday fluctuations apply |
| Enterprise Value Range | $2.1 to $2.3 Trillion | Analyst Consensus, Mid-2024 | Includes market cap plus net debt and preferred equity |
| Annual Revenue Run Rate | $620 to $650 Billion | Trailing Twelve Months | Covers North America, International, and AWS |
| Reported Net Income | $35 to $40 Billion | Latest Fiscal Year | Non-GAAP and GAAP variants differ due to stock compensation and taxes |

Impact Of AWS Margins On Total Value
Amazon Web Services generates outsized operating profit relative to its revenue share, lifting the company’s overall valuation multiple. Strong free cash flow from cloud supports share buybacks and long-term strategic bets.
E Commerce Scale And Competitive Position
North America and International segments drive top-line growth through Prime membership, expanding SKU counts, and advertising services. Competitive dynamics with regional players and new AI-driven shopping experiences shape margin trajectories.
Logistics network density and last-mile efficiency create structural advantages that are difficult for new entrants to replicate at similar scale.

Macroeconomic And Regulatory Considerations
Interest rate environments influence the discounted cash flow models used to estimate intrinsic amazon net worth. Currency headwinds in International segments and antitrust scrutiny in multiple jurisdictions introduce variability into long-term forecasts.
Sustainability initiatives and labor practices also affect brand equity, which can translate into tangible value differences in customer acquisition and retention.

How Is Amazon Net Worth Different From Market Capitalization?
Market capitalization reflects the equity value of the company based on share price, while enterprise value includes net debt and preferred stock for a more complete picture of amazon net worth.
What Portion Of Amazon Value Comes From Amazon Web Services?
AWS contributes a small fraction of revenue but a large share of operating profit, meaning its performance disproportionately influences overall valuation and perceived amazon net worth.
Can Amazon Net Worth Be Directly Compared To Traditional Retailers?
Traditional retailers typically trade at lower multiples due to thinner margins and slower growth, so Amazon commands a premium that reflects its cloud business and ecosystem strength.
